Filing the Lawsuit

If you and your attorney decide to move forward with the case, the next step is filing a formal lawsuit. Your attorney will draft a complaint outlining the details of your injuries, the responsible party, and the damages sought. The complaint is then filed with the appropriate court in Crestview. The defendant will be served with a copy of the complaint, notifying them of the legal action against them.

Discovery Phase

Once the lawsuit is filed, both parties engage in the discovery process. This phase allows each side to gather evidence, exchange information, and build their case. Discovery methods include interrogatories (written questions), depositions (sworn testimony), requests for documents, and requests for admission. The discovery phase helps both parties understand the strengths and weaknesses of their case and can often lead to settlement negotiations.

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) in Crestview

Many personal injury cases in Crestview are resolved through alternative dispute resolution methods, such as mediation or arbitration. ADR allows the parties to negotiate a settlement without going to trial. Mediation involves a neutral third-party mediator who facilitates discussions between the parties to reach a mutually agreeable resolution. Arbitration, on the other hand, is a more formal process where an arbitrator reviews the evidence and makes a binding decision.

Trial Proceedings

If a settlement cannot be reached through ADR or if the parties choose to proceed to trial, the case will go before a judge or jury. Both sides present their evidence during the trial, call witnesses, and make arguments. The judge or jury then decides the outcome of the case based on the presented evidence and applicable laws.
